# The profiles in this file were derived from NASA MERRA2 reanalysis
# data, temporally and spatially averaged using the Giovanni online
# data system developed and maintained by the NASA Goddard Earth
# Sciences Data and Information Services Center (GES DISC).
#
# The following files were averaged over the full year:
#
#  g4.curtainTime.M2IMNPASM_5_12_4_T.20061201-20161130.180W_66S_180E_23S.nc
#  g4.curtainTime.M2IMNPASM_5_12_4_QV.20061201-20161130.180W_66S_180E_23S.nc
#  g4.curtainTime.M2IMNPASM_5_12_4_O3.20061201-20161130.180W_66S_180E_23S.nc
#  g4.curtainTime.M2IMNPASM_5_12_4_H.20061201-20161130.180W_66S_180E_23S.nc
#
# MERRA references:
#   M. M. Rienecker et al. (2011), MERRA: NASA's Modern-Era Retrospective
#   Analysis for Research and Applications. J. Climate 24:3624.
#
#   A. Molod et al (2015), Development of the GEOS-5 atmospheric general
#   circulation model: evolution from MERRA to MERRA2.  Geoscience Model
#   Development 8:1339.
#
# MERRA is produced by the NASA/Goddard Global Modeling and Assimilation
# Office (GMAO).  MERRA data are archived and distributed by the
# GES DISC.
